Kyrgyzstan is a landlocked country in Central Asia, known for its mountainous landscape dominated by the Tian Shan range. It borders Kazakhstan, Uzbekistan, Tajikistan, and China. The country has a parliamentary-presidential system, with Bishkek as its capital and largest city. Kyrgyzstan has a rich nomadic heritage and cultural diversity, and it plays an important role in regional cooperation in Central Asia.

Caşıl Ay Koomu Association is a non-profit organization based in Bishkek, Kyrgyzstan, with its official address at Radishev Street No. 12, Bishkek. A Goodwill Agreement was signed in Bishkek in 2017, and the association completed its official establishment in 2018. Caşıl Ay Koomu has been a member of IFGC since 2018 and was elected to the IFGC High Advisory Board in 2025.The President of the association is Mr. Nurlanbek Daminov. The organization focuses on prevention, awareness, and community-based activities addressing addiction related to drugs, alcohol, and similar forms of addiction, contributing to public health and social well-being in Kyrgyzstan.
